在现代企业网络环境中,远程办公、分支机构互联和移动员工接入已成为常态,为了保障数据传输的安全性与私密性,搭建一个稳定、安全的内网VPN(虚拟私人网络)至关重要,作为网络工程师,我将详细介绍如何在局域网(内网)中搭建一套完整的VPN解决方案,适用于中小型企业或家庭办公场景。

明确需求是关键,你需要决定使用哪种类型的VPN协议——常见的有OpenVPN、IPSec、WireGuard等,OpenVPN因其开源、跨平台支持和高安全性而广受青睐;WireGuard则以轻量级和高性能著称,适合对延迟敏感的应用;而IPSec常用于企业级设备间互联,如路由器到路由器的站点到站点连接,根据你的硬件条件、预算和管理复杂度选择最适合的方案。

准备基础环境,假设你有一台运行Linux(如Ubuntu Server)的服务器作为VPN网关,且该服务器已分配固定IP地址并能访问外网,确保防火墙(如UFW或iptables)开放必要的端口,例如OpenVPN默认使用UDP 1194端口,WireGuard使用UDP 12345端口等,在路由器上配置端口转发(Port Forwarding),使外部用户可通过公网IP访问你的VPN服务。

以OpenVPN为例,安装步骤如下:

  1. 安装OpenVPN及相关工具(如easy-rsa);
  2. 使用easy-rsa生成CA证书、服务器证书和客户端证书;
  3. 配置服务器端的server.conf文件,设置子网段(如10.8.0.0/24)、加密方式(AES-256)、认证方式(TLS)等;
  4. 启动服务并设置开机自启;
  5. 为每个客户端生成唯一配置文件(.ovpn),包含证书、密钥和服务器地址;
  6. 将客户端配置分发给用户,导入至OpenVPN客户端软件(Windows、Android、iOS均可支持)。

建议启用双重认证(如结合Google Authenticator)提升安全性,防止证书被盗用,定期更新证书、监控日志、限制并发连接数,避免DDoS攻击或资源耗尽。

测试与优化:通过客户端连接测试连通性和速度,检查是否能访问内网资源(如文件服务器、打印机),若出现延迟或丢包,可调整MTU值或切换协议(如从TCP改为UDP)。

内网搭建VPN不仅是技术实践,更是网络安全体系的重要一环,合理规划、严格配置和持续维护,才能让远程访问既便捷又安全,对于非专业人员,推荐使用成熟的一键部署脚本(如OpenVPN Access Server)降低门槛,但无论何种方式,安全始终是第一位的——毕竟,你的内网,值得被保护。

内网搭建VPN,实现安全远程访问的完整指南  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N